Official Names and Models

 

While the official model names are yet to be confirmed, the designs and features suggest we’ll likely see two variants: the Motorola Edge 60 and the Motorola Edge 60 Pro.

Design and Color Variations

The standard Motorola Edge 60 is expected to be available in vibrant turquoise, blue, and rose pink shades. On the other hand, the Edge 60 Pro will likely feature an elegant palette of violet, green, and dark blue. Both models boast a chic vegan leather finish on the back, adding a touch of luxury and sustainability.

Frame Material and Build

The absence of antenna lines in the leaked images hints at a possible departure from the traditional metal frame, suggesting a new material might be in play. Design-wise, both models share a similar aesthetic, though the Edge 60 Pro sports a subtly curved display. Each has a punch-hole front camera, with the usual volume and power buttons on the right. The bottom hosts the charging port, speaker grille, and SIM slot. Notably, the Edge 60 Pro features an additional button on the left, rumored to activate a recording function.

Camera Capabilities

Both the Edge 60 and Edge 60 Pro are equipped with a 50MP Sony Lytia 900 sensor, promising exceptional image quality with optical image stabilization (OIS). The primary difference lies in their zoom capabilities:

  • Motorola Edge 60: Offers a focal range of 12mm to 24mm.
  • Motorola Edge 60 Pro: Extends from 12mm to 73mm, enhancing its telephoto performance.
